Thank you. Couple of small details to note. The GT/CS grille has three holes in the driver's side block off plate for the factory tribar. I opted to plug these up with small plastic caps. It's a small detail, but I like stuff to have that finished look.

The tribar itself is a Scott Drake reproduction. Its a nice piece, but just like the originals it uses speed nuts. I hate these things, and because the posts are longer than what you need here, the risk of breaking them is greater. One of mine broke during mock up, and it was a pain to retap.

Lastly, I located mine a bit more towards center, and lined up the frame of the tribar with one of the indentations in the grille's slats. Because the emblem sits on a black plastic base that's canted to square it up with the road, its kind of hard to find the right position. It took a bit of trial and error to find the right spot.

Its a bit more work than using the current factory emblem, but I think the old style version works better. Just my preference.

On the splitter, its hard to beat the GT/CS piece for the money. Installation is easy, and it doesn't jut out too far, but its still noticeable versus stock. I like that it doesn't sit any lower than the standard splitter, so I don't worry so much about clearance issues. There's a few chin splitters that look pretty cool (I think Steeda makes one that has an indentation that echos the shape of the lower grill, which looks nice), but since I'm going for a "what if Ford made a Mach 1 for the 2015-17" kind of concept, the GT/CS fit the bill perfectly. Note that Ford used the GT/CS chin splitter on the 2012/13 Boss 302, for my example.

2morrow....
That's what I was hoping I could do. But the problem I ran into was in where I put the decal.

To be proper to the 69 Mach, the rear quarter decal surrounds the marker light. But the 69 light is quite a bit taller than the s550 version.

When I put the decals on...I started at the front and worked back. I used the line at the bottom of the door to keep it straight. I put it just under that line.

When I got to the rear quarter, the stripe was too high to have the marker centered in the stripe. But what I did find was if I would have put the upper smaller outside line of the decal above the body line, it would have been really close to being able to work in the back.

Unfortunately I was done with the rest of it by then. But if anyone else wanted to try using the 69 stripes...I do think it would work pretty good. Just notch out the center stripe for the marker some.
